ADLER AFTER DARK FEATURING SKY WHITE TIGER


July's “Adler After Dark” (Thursday, July 15) will feature two sets by Brooklyn-based psych-pop outfit Sky White Tiger. Led by Louis Schwadron (ex-Polyphonic Spree), the band is inspired by works of astrological mythology and creates original music that is accompanied by virtual landscapes. Sky White Tiger aims to embed and amplify the mobile art form of live music into the planetarium setting by utilizing video dome projections, constellation-based imagery and light-based costume design.

Opener DJ Plastic Crimewave was born one Steven H Krakow and was quickly drawn to colorful comic books, the Byrds and Mad Magazine and it's basically been a straight line ever since, delving deeper into 60's psychedelia, cartooning and all things vibrationally bizarre. He heads up the Plastic Crimewave Sound, a spaced-out acid punk ensemble inspired by the underground sounds of Velvet Underground, Krautrock, biker jams and freeform musics.
